将外部图像加载到空符号 as3

load external image to empty symbol as3

我正在尝试将图像加载到符号。

我查看了每个答案,但似乎他们有类似解决方案的旁路,但没有解释如何让图像出现在空符号中。

这是我的代码,我拿到这里并可以使用,但图像未分配给符号。

var loader:Loader = new Loader();
    loader.contentLoaderInfo.addEventListener(Event.COMPLETE, onComplete);
    loader.load(new URLRequest("Red_X.png"));

function onComplete (event:Event):void
{
    addChild(Bitmap(LoaderInfo(event.target).content));
}

提前致谢。

无需等待加载程序完成并提取其内容。只需立即添加 Loader。

要添加到不同的容器,您必须调用该容器的 add 方法。

var loader:Loader = new Loader();
empty.addChild(loader);
loader.load(new URLRequest("Red_X.png"));